The Power Duo: Kidman and Fanning's New Legal Thriller
The world of streaming is buzzing with the announcement of a new legal thriller, 'Discretion', coming to Paramount+. With a star-studded cast and an intriguing premise, this series is already generating a lot of excitement in the industry.
At the helm, we have Matt Shakman, a director with an impressive resume. He's fresh off the success of 'WandaVision', a Marvel series that earned him an Emmy nomination. But what's particularly interesting is his reunion with Elle Fanning. These two previously collaborated on 'The Great', a Hulu series that showcased Fanning's talent and earned Shakman critical acclaim. This dynamic duo is now back, and I can't help but wonder if lightning will strike twice.
The series is based on a fictional short story by Chandler Baker, who also serves as an executive producer. It's a classic tale of power dynamics and hidden secrets within a law firm. Elle Fanning plays Lenny, a young associate who discovers a web of non-disclosure agreements (NDAs) concealing a dark truth. This is where the story takes an intriguing turn, as it's not just about uncovering a scandal but also about the mentor-protégé relationship between Lenny and the firm's powerful partner, Sharon, played by the legendary Nicole Kidman. The question of who holds the power to keep secrets and at what cost is a compelling narrative thread.
What makes this project even more fascinating is the production house behind it, A24. Known for their unique and often edgy content, A24 has a knack for producing films and series that leave a lasting impression. With their involvement, we can expect 'Discretion' to be more than just a typical legal drama.
The series also boasts an impressive list of executive producers, including Susannah Grant and Jordan Cerf, indicating a strong creative force driving the project.
